Transaction 71c04c319f4d89eeac4390903732cd7f556739fd62e93c13fe19190832d670e5

54 Input
2 Outputs
  • 71c04c319f4d89eeac4390903732cd7f556739fd62e93c13fe19190832d670e5:0
  • value  2600000
    address  1Mc59gAXowJRMHxbci6oFxe25rxbWZV8nR
  • 71c04c319f4d89eeac4390903732cd7f556739fd62e93c13fe19190832d670e5:1
  • value  1078034
    address  1PGugimfxR7H8mFGsfXKs8hCyLsACeDtp2